Dixie Fish does vibrant things with narrative and voice. The novel chronicles the life of Walt Whitman Woodcock, a Southwest Texas ranch boy who comes to Columbia, SC with a seven-point plan for achieving true bliss. Armed with a phonographic memory--everything he hears, he remembers--a job waiting tables at the Dixie Fish, and a fraudulent admission to graduate school, W. W. W. sets about the task of creating nirvana in the capital of South Carolina . . .
